Output ef3ab3c9f097649225cddc03a3e5417aee7029f51ad449e60bcf0960930ca11f:105

value
50175845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56a7d8203652d8832ceb30d6b622d604f080cb0e OP_EQUAL
address
39bD74dw6ouUYoK9gESE98sVGZj1mgiNXF
transaction
ef3ab3c9f097649225cddc03a3e5417aee7029f51ad449e60bcf0960930ca11f
spent
true